Amazon Australia’s content editor Shannon Molloy to return to News Corp
Amazon’s first Australian content editor, Shannon Molloy, is headed back to News Corp, where he will take on the role of senior reporter.
Molloy, who was previously a digital reporter and producer at News Corp for four years, joined the Australian arm of Amazon in October last year.
Molloy announced on Twitter he would return back to the publisher’s online platform, news.com.au.

Beyond News Corp, Molloy has worked across a variety of publications including TV Week and Australian Property Investor Magazine.
On his return to News Corp, Molloy told Mumbrella: “I’ve really missed journalism this past year – much more than I expected to. So, I’m very excited to be getting back to where I belong, on the tools and breaking yarns, at Australia’s number one news website.”
Molloy’s replacement at Amazon Australia has not been announced.
